Naked puts: Let’s say that XYZ is currently trading at $210.We can sell a put contract with a strike price of $180 that expires 6 weeks in the future. In exchange for agreeing to buy XYZ if it falls below $180, we receive a credit (“option premium” or “premium”) of $2 / share.Nov 10, 2023 · 3. Selling Cash-Secured Puts – The Safest Options Strategy. The What: Selling a cash-secured put obligates you to buy 100 shares of the stock at the designated strike price on or before the expiration date. For taking on this obligation, you will be paid a premium. Stock Options In Retirement: Consider Covered Calls. This could be done by purchasing one January 40 put with a $0.50 premium at a cost of $50 ($0.50 premium times 100 shares controlled by the one contract) and one January 60 call with a $0.50 premium at a cost of $50 ($0.50 premium times 100 shares …Safe Option Strategies #3: Buying/Selling Verticals. A vertical options trade consists of 2 legs, similar to the diagonal spread. You go long an option and short an option with different strikes. However, the expiration period is the same. That is the key difference between a vertical as well as a diagonal spread.

What's a long call? A long call is a bullish strategy that involves buying a call option. Long is a term describing ownership, meaning you hold the option. Owning a call option gives you the right, but not the obligation, to buy 100 shares of the underlying stock or ETF at the strike price by the option’s expiration date.

A strangle is an options strategy that lets investors profit when they correctly determine whether a share’s price is likely to change significantly or remain within a small price range. A long strangle lets investors profit when the price of a stock moves significantly, and a short strangle allows profit when the ...Nov 14, 2023 · 9) Long Straddles & Short Straddles. A weekly at-the-money call option sells for $1.55 per share, while a similar put option sells for $1.56. Remember, both have a strike price of $105. By selling the call and buying the put, you’re completely hedged. The transaction also results in a cash inflow of 1 cent per share or $1 per contract.

The covered call strategy is one of the safest option strategies that you can execute. In theory, this strategy requires an investor to purchase actual shares of a company (at least 100 shares) while concurrently selling a call option.

Friday expiration straddle strategy.Jan 16, 2023 · A call option contract at $100 strike is available for $2, expiring in six months. ABC eventually expires at $110, leaving the investor with a profit of $8: $110 – ($100 + $2). A contract is worth 100 shares, so the net profit is $800; or $1,600 if two option contracts were purchased.
